The Rise of Pixel Weather: A Brief Retrospective
Before we explore the newcomer, it's crucial to understand the context set by Google's own offering. The Pixel Weather app wasn't just another pre-installed utility; it was a statement. Following years of relying on third-party integrations or more generic weather functionalities within Google Assistant or Search, the dedicated Pixel Weather app brought a cohesive, branded experience to the Pixel ecosystem. Its design language was unmistakably Google's Material You, characterized by soft pastels, fluid animations, and intuitive layouts. Key features like the detailed hourly and daily forecasts, severe weather alerts, and the aforementioned pollen tracker were lauded for their accuracy and user-friendliness. For many, it represented the pinnacle of what a first-party Android weather application could be – deeply integrated, visually appealing, and genuinely useful. It set a high bar, demonstrating that even a seemingly simple app could benefit from thoughtful design and robust data integration. The app's success underscored a growing user demand for not just data, but elegantly presented, actionable insights into their local climate.

The Competitive Landscape: Innovation vs. Integration
The emergence of Gradient Weather highlights a fascinating dynamic in the Android app ecosystem: the constant tension between first-party integration and third-party innovation. Google's Pixel Weather benefits from deep system-level integration, often appearing seamlessly within the OS and leveraging Google's vast data infrastructure. This provides a certain level of reliability and consistency that can be hard for independent developers to match. However, third-party apps like Gradient Weather often have the advantage of agility and a singular focus. They are not beholden to broader corporate design guidelines or the need to serve multiple product lines. This allows them to experiment more freely with user interfaces, incorporate cutting-edge design trends, and respond more rapidly to user feedback.
Historically, this pattern has played out across various app categories. Google Maps, for instance, is deeply integrated into Android, but Waze, a third-party acquisition, offered superior real-time traffic and community-driven alerts for years. Similarly, while Google Photos offers robust cloud backup, many users prefer third-party gallery apps for their advanced editing features or organizational tools. The success of Gradient Weather suggests that even with a strong first-party offering, there's always room for an independent developer to carve out a niche by offering a more specialized, refined, or feature-rich experience. This competition ultimately benefits the end-user, driving both Google and independent developers to continually improve their offerings.
